Output f18a22a8dfb76a1633424e653c778d8857a09f2dde627361684e8a62da61890b:1

value
41627804
script pubkey
OP_0 OP_PUSHBYTES_20 6d34f4968e2f44b0417b0a8219d396ac89deef3c
address
bc1qd560f95w9aztqstmp2ppn5uk4jyaameuqgre2w
transaction
f18a22a8dfb76a1633424e653c778d8857a09f2dde627361684e8a62da61890b
confirmations
169362
spent
true